Output 8569b678a4b194eb16f62ce396912ddd5d397d40c2245e69fdb33ed49ee1ee68:0

value
1599010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46b660c453db24e6ebed8bb179299619f758dd71 OP_EQUALVERIFY OP_CHECKSIG
address
17StnGroPUsNXBq4AVJQ1fqGftoFZh3zva
transaction
8569b678a4b194eb16f62ce396912ddd5d397d40c2245e69fdb33ed49ee1ee68
confirmations
56293
spent
true